    Default Self Induced Therapy?

    I had a thought the other day and wondered if anyone had tried this or if it's a crazy idea. I thought about taking something that will make me V* a couple times a month or something, to try to desensitize myself and overcome the fear that has a hold over me. Sometimes it sounds like a good idea, and sometimes I think it sounds completely crazy. Thoughts?

    Default Re: Self Induced Therapy?

    I never took anything that I thought would "make" me sick, but I did try fingers in the throat to induce vomiting. It was not nearly as easy as as I had expected; but the results were not as bad as I expected either. The problem was, it wasn't the same thing as actually getting sick; and it did not help my anxiety and worry.

    Default Re: Self Induced Therapy?

    I'm honestly not sure it's a good idea. It could end up traumatizing you. Personally I've watched some videos on YouTube of people vomiting and I have found that it's helped me. I mean of course it's different than ME actually vomiting, but I've found that it doesn't scare me as much as it used to. The videos do show you that people do it and live through it. Some people even laugh while they do it. You might want to try that route first. You can start by watching drunk folks at first since they aren't suffering from the sv and it's not quite as traumatic for them. Just my .02.
